ABSTRACT

Objective:

To revise the Chinese version of the Social Comparison Orientation Scale.

Methods:

The questionnaire was administered to two samples with total of 1023 individuals.

Results:

The item analysis showed that all of the 11 items met psychometric criteria. The confirmatory factor analysis indicated that the Chinese version of Social Comparison Scale was composed of two dimensions, which were ability and concept, which can explained 55. 6% of total variance. The internal consistency reliability was 0. 88 and the four weeks tesl-retest reliability coefficient was 0. 89.
